Summary: On 25/08/2005, the Supreme Court heard Daljit Singh's petition for special leave to appeal against a High Court of Punjab & Haryana order dated 25/04/2005. The bench of Justices B.P. Singh and S.H. Kapadia adjourned the matter for two weeks, directing that if the State of Haryana appears through counsel, both sides will be heard; otherwise, the court will dispose of the matter based on the existing record.
